Air filtration efficiency refers to the ability of a filter to remove contaminants from the air. High efficiency means the filter can capture smaller particles, which is essential in industries where air quality directly impacts product quality and worker safety. Over time, however, filters can become clogged or damaged, reducing their efficiency. Regular maintenance is key to preserving air filtration efficiency.
Several factors influence air filtration efficiency. Contaminant load, filter age, and airflow rate are the most significant. As filters accumulate particles, their efficiency drops. Similarly, older filters may have degraded materials, further compromising performance. Ensuring proper airflow is also crucial, as excessive or insufficient airflow can affect filtration effectiveness.

Air release valves play a vital role in air filtration systems by preventing pressure buildup and releasing trapped moisture. roper air release valve maintenance ensures these valves function correctly, prolonging system life and improving efficiency. Neglecting maintenance can lead to leaks, reduced performance, and even system failure.
Maintaining air release valves involves cleaning, inspecting, and replacing worn parts. Annual inspections are recommended to ensure valves are free from debris and functioning as intended. Using the right tools and techniques for air release valve maintenance can prevent costly downtime and maintain system reliability.
